Introduction

APRALO will organize a showcase event during the ICANN Singapore meeting in June 2011.  The purpose of this Showcase includes:

  • To highlight the activites of the ALSes in the Asian, Australasian and Pacific Islands region; and
  • To facilitate outreach activities for regional Internet user organizations attending ICANN's Singapore Meeting.

Similiar events were held by LACRALO at the ICANN Cartagena Meeting, AFRALO at the ICANN Nairobi Meeting, EURALO at the Brussels Meeting, and NARALO at the Silicon Valley Meeting.

Mandate of this Working Group

The purpose of the APRALO Singapore Showcase WG includes:  

  • Determining the best date, time, and location for the Showcase.
  • Developing the Showcase agenda, including: 
    • Deciding whether or not there should be an overarching theme;
    • Identifying and inviting the keynote speaker;
    • Identifying and arranging for the Showcases' other speakers; 
    • Establishing the order of events, including the speaker order; and
    • Confirming which APRALO ALSes will have representatives present their ALSes at the Showcase.
  • Collecting and organizing materials to be available at the Showcase from all of APRALO's ALSes (including ALS Fact Sheets, posters, brochures etc.).
  • Deciding how this ALS material will be presented.
